Question- Unable to open Quickbooks ? What to do Solution?

Answer- If you're unable to open QuickBooks, there could be various reasons behind the issue. Here are some troubleshooting steps to help you resolve the problem:

Restart Your Computer:

Sometimes, a simple restart can resolve temporary glitches. Close all applications, restart your computer, and then try opening QuickBooks again.

Run QuickBooks Diagnostic Tool:

QuickBooks provides a tool called QuickBooks Install Diagnostic Tool that can help fix various issues, including problems preventing QuickBooks from opening. Download and run this tool from the official QuickBooks website.

Check for System Requirements:

Ensure that your computer meets the system requirements for the version of QuickBooks you are using. Incompatible systems may lead to issues with opening the software.

Update QuickBooks:

Make sure you have the latest updates installed for QuickBooks. Updates often include bug fixes and improvements. If you can't open QuickBooks, manually download and install the latest updates from the official QuickBooks website.

Run QuickBooks as an Administrator:

Right-click on the QuickBooks shortcut icon and select "Run as administrator." Elevated privileges may help overcome permission-related issues.

Check for Error Messages:

If there is an error message when trying to open QuickBooks, take note of the message. You can use the error message as a reference when seeking help from QuickBooks support or searching for solutions online.

Repair QuickBooks Installation:

Go to the "Control Panel" > "Programs and Features," find QuickBooks in the list, and choose "Repair." This will repair any damaged or missing files in the QuickBooks installation.

Disable Antivirus and Firewall:

Your antivirus or firewall software might be blocking QuickBooks. Temporarily disable your security software and check if you can open QuickBooks. If it works, you may need to add QuickBooks as an exception in your security settings.

Restore a Backup:

If you have a recent backup of your company file, try restoring it to see if the issue is related to the company file itself.

Contact QuickBooks Support:

If none of the above steps resolves the issue, it's recommended to contact QuickBooks support for assistance. They can provide specific guidance based on the nature of the problem.

Always ensure that you have a backup of your QuickBooks company file before making any changes or attempting major troubleshooting steps.
